Typical Indications of Moisture in a Building
Dampness problems within a structure can manifest via several obvious indicators that suggest the visibility of moisture. One noticeable indicator is the look of water spots on ceilings or walls, which frequently indicates dampness infiltration. Additionally, bubbling or peeling paint can suggest that excess moisture is trapped under the surface, leading to degeneration. One more common sign is the visibility of mold and mildew and mildew, which thrive in wet problems and can typically be recognized by their mildewy smell. Moreover, a rise in moisture levels can cause condensation on home windows and other surface areas, highlighting dampness troubles. Unequal or warped flooring may signal underlying dampness that jeopardizes architectural integrity. Recognizing these indicators early can assist reduce possible damages and preserve a risk-free living environment. Routine evaluations and timely activity are important in dealing with dampness concerns prior to they intensify.

Different Types of Damp Proofing Solutions
Different variables can add to damp concerns in buildings, picking the ideal moist proofing remedy is vital for maintaining structural honesty. Numerous alternatives are readily available, each customized to details conditions.One typical solution is a damp-proof membrane (DPM), typically made from polyethylene or bitumen, which is installed in wall surfaces and floors to protect against dampness ingress. An additional alternative is damp-proof training courses (DPC), which are layers of waterproof product put within wall surfaces to obstruct climbing damp.Chemical damp proofing includes injecting waterproofing chemicals right into walls to create a barrier against dampness. Furthermore, outside treatments such as tanking, which involves using a water-proof layer to the outside of structures, can be efficient in avoiding water penetration.Each option has its advantages and is picked based upon the building's certain problems, ecological conditions, and long-term maintenance considerations, making certain ideal defense versus damp-related damages.

Selecting the Right Damp Proofing Approach for Your Property
Which damp proofing technique is most ideal for a particular home frequently depends upon numerous factors, including the building's age, existing wetness concerns, and local environmental conditions. For older structures, traditional techniques such as asphalt membrane layers or cementitious finishes may be more effective, as they can offer a robust barrier against increasing wet. In comparison, newer structures could profit from modern-day services like infused damp-proof training courses, which are less invasive and can be tailored to details wetness challenges.Additionally, residential properties in locations with high water tables or heavy rainfall might require advanced strategies, such as cavity wall water drainage systems or exterior waterproofing. Property owners must also think about the certain products made use of in their building's construction, as some methods may not work. Eventually, a detailed assessment by a professional can direct building proprietors in picking the most effective wet proofing method customized to their unique situations.
Maintaining Your Damp Proofing System In Time
Regular maintenance of a moist proofing system is necessary for guaranteeing its long-term performance and shielding a residential or commercial property from moisture-related damage. Home owners should perform routine inspections to determine any signs of wear or concession in the wet proofing layer. This consists of checking for cracks, peeling paint, or mold growth, which might show wetness intrusion.Additionally, it is suggested to tidy gutters and downspouts consistently to avoid water build-up around the structure. If wear and tear is observed.Engaging specialist services for routine assessments can further improve the resilience of the system, reapplying sealers or membranes might be required. These experts can offer understandings into prospective susceptabilities and recommend prompt repairs.
